English Bay
English Bay is a bay in Kenai Peninsula, Alaska. English Bay is situated nearby to the hamlet Port Graham.Places of Interest

Nanwalek Airport is a state-owned public-use airport located in Nanwalek, an unincorporated community in the Kenai Peninsula Borough of the US state of Alaska. It was formerly known as English Bay Airport.

Nanwalek, formerly Alexandrovsk and later English Bay, is a census-designated place in the Kenai Peninsula Borough, Alaska, United States, that contains a traditional Alutiiq village.
